The secret weapon at Stoke City

Tuesday, 11 November 08, 02:10 PM · Comments(1)

You’ve probably seen this ridiculousness already if you pay attention to the EPL, but we haven’t mentioned it yet on this site.

Stoke City, in their first Premier League season since the 80s, is sitting at 12th in the table right now with 14 points in 12 games. And without midfielder Rory Delap, there’s not telling where the club would be.

Delap has a God-given ability to throw a soccer ball harder, lower and longer than you’ve ever seen in your life. Seriously, if he had taken up baseball I bet his fastball would be untouchable. Whenever Stoke gets a throw-in anywhere past midfield, Delap’s rocket-slinging arms send a certified missile into the penalty box that functions as an extremely dangerous free kick.

Not a believer? Well check out this five-minute highlight clip and then get back to me.

Count Arsenal among the first-hand witnesses after Delap’s throws produced both goals in Stoke’s 2-1 victory on November 1.
